全部产品

云端配置

更新时间:2020-09-02 16:14:32

使用物模型接入物联网平台的第一步是在物联网平台控制台配置产品、定义物模型、添加设备。本文以充电桩产品为例进行演示。

创建产品

产品是设备的集合,通常是一组具有相同功能定义的设备集合。在设备上云之前,需要在物联网平台上,为设备创建一个所属产品。详细操作和说明,请参见创建产品

  1. 登录物联网平台控制台

  2. 在左侧导航栏,选择设备管理 > 产品,单击创建产品

  3. 按照页面提示填写信息,然后单击保存

    充电桩产品

    参数

    描述

    产品名称

    为产品命名。产品名称在账号内具有唯一性。例如,可以填写为产品型号。支持中文、英文字母、数字、下划线(_)、连接号(-)、@符号和英文圆括号,长度限制4~30个字符,一个中文汉字计为2个字符。

    所属品类

    相当于产品模板。本示例中选择标准品类下的商业共享/共享租赁服务/充电桩

    节点类型

    产品下设备的类型。此处选择直连设备

    连网方式

    直连设备的连网方式。

    数据格式

    设备上下行的数据格式。

    • ICA标准数据格式(Alink JSON):是物联网平台为开发者提供的设备与云端的数据交换协议,采用JSON格式。

    • 透传/自定义:如果您希望使用自定义的串口数据格式,可以选择为透传/自定义。

      您需在控制台提交数据解析脚本,将上行的自定义格式的数据转换为Alink JSON格式;将下行的Alink JSON格式数据解析为设备自定义格式,设备才能与云端进行通信。

    本示例中选择ICA标准数据格式(Alink JSON)

定义物模型

物模型指将物理空间中的实体数字化,并在云端构建该实体的数据模型。物模型通过属性、事件、服务三要素描述了设备所具备的能力,也实现了设备与云的交互、设备与客户端服务器的通信等协议的标准化。

如果您定义的物模型足够通用和专业,阿里云物联网平台协助您,将该物模型作为ICA行业标准进行推广。

在物联网平台中,定义物模型即定义产品功能。完成功能定义后,系统将自动生成该产品的物模型。本示例中,在您创建产品时选择的商业共享/共享租赁服务/充电桩模板基础上,继续增加物模型。详细操作说明请参见物模型

  1. 在左侧导航栏,选择设备管理 > 产品

  2. 产品页面产品列表中,单击充电桩产品对应操作栏中的查看

  3. 产品详情页,单击功能定义页签,再单击编辑草稿

  4. 选择添加自定义功能。详细参数说明请参见单个添加物模型

    • 自定义属性:本示例中,按如下图设置属性参数。

      充电桩产品添加属性

    • 自定义服务:本示例中,按如下图设置服务参数。

      充电桩产品添加自定义服务

      按如下图所示,设置服务的输入参数

      充电桩-服务-输入参数

      按如下图所示,设置服务的输出参数

      充电桩-服务-输出参数

    • 自定义事件:本示例中,按如下图设置事件参数。

      充电桩产品添加事件

      按如下图所示,设置事件的输出参数

      充电桩产品事件的输出参数

  5. 发布物模型。

    发布充电桩产品的物模型

    发布物模型成功后,可在功能定义页签单击物模型 TSL,查看物模型完整代码。

    充电桩产品完整物模型代码

添加设备

创建完产品后,需要为设备创建身份。您可以创建单个设备,也可以批量创建设备。

创建设备的详细操作,请参见如下文档:

  • 单个创建设备:设备数量为1~2个时,可单个创建设备,通常在测试阶段使用较多。

  • 批量创建设备:设备数量较多时,可批量创建设备,通常在量产阶段使用。

本示例中,在充电桩产品下创建1个设备,获取设备证书信息。

  1. 在充电桩产品的产品详情页,单击前往管理

    充电桩-前往管理

  2. 设备页,单击添加设备

  3. 添加设备对话框中,输入设备信息,单击确认

    充电桩添加设备

    设备创建成功后,您可以查看设备证书。设备证书由设备的ProductKey、DeviceName和DeviceSecret组成,是设备与物联网平台进行通信的重要身份认证,建议您妥善保管。

    充电桩设备证书

至此,您已完成云端配置。

后续步骤

设备开发